folie, aluminiumfolie

thin, flexible metal sheet used for wrapping, covering, or cooking food

transparent, overheadsheet

a thin, clear sheet of material, often used for creating visual aids to be projected using an overhead projector

foil, fena

a thin, flat, or curved structure, such as a metal plate or blade, designed to react against air or water flow and generate control motion

kontrast, motvikt

something that provides a contrast that emphasizes or enhances another's qualities

floret, vapen använt i fäktning

a type of sword used in the sport of fencing, characterized by its flexible blade and specific rules for scoring points

kontrastfigur, motståndare

a character in a literary work who contrasts with another character, usually the protagonist, to highlight specific traits of the latter
to foil
01

omintetgöra, förhindra

to stop or hinder someone's plans or efforts
Transitive: to foil a plan

Exempel
Unforeseen circumstances can sometimes foil our attempts to achieve certain goals.
Oförutsedda omständigheter kan ibland göra motstånd mot våra försök att uppnå vissa mål.

kontrastera, framhäva

to make something stand out or become more noticeable by placing it next to something that contrasts with it
Transitive: to foil sth
Exempel
The elegance of the antique furniture foiled the modern design of the room.
Den antika möbelns elegans kontrasterade mot rummets moderna design.

svepa in, täcka

to cover or wrap something with a flexible metal sheet, typically for protection or cooking purposes
Transitive: to foil food material
